Montana Democrats picking candidate for congressional seat

Democrats from across Montana converged in the capital Sunday to nominate a candidate to fill the state’s only congressional seat, vacated by Republican Rep. Ryan Zinke to lead the U.S. Interior Department. About 150 delegates were choosing from eight candidates, including two legislators and several political newcomers, to represent the Democratic Party in a special election May 25. “I come here not as a career politician rising through the ranks,” said Rob Quist, a well-known entertainer.
